A network manager would like to have network management
capabilities when
(a) a component of the network fails,
(b) a component of the network is about to fail, and is acting "flaky"
(c) a component of the network has been compromised from a
security standpoint and is attacking the network, e.g., by
launching a DOS attack by flooding the network with packets,
(d) traffic levels exceed a certain threshold on a link, causing packets
to be dropped,
(e) everything is running smoothly (in order to know that everything is
running smoothly and there are no problems).
There are many additional reasons as well.

External virtual networks.Use this type when you want to provide virtual machines with access to a physical network to communicate with externally located servers and clients. This type of virtual network also allows virtual machines on the same virtualizationserver to communicate with each other. This type of network may also be available for use by the management operating system, depending on how you configure the networking. (The management operating system runs the Hyper-Vrole.) For more information, see "A closer look at external virtual networks" later in this topic.NoteHyper-Vdoes not support wireless networks. An external virtual network provides access to a physical network through a wired physical network adapter.Internal virtual networks.Use this type when you want to allow communication between virtual machines on the same virtualizationserver and between virtual machines and the management operating system. This type of virtual network is commonly used to build a test environment in which you need to connect to the virtual machines from the management operating system. An internal virtual network is not bound to a physical network adapter. As a result, an internal virtual network is isolated from all external network traffic.Private virtual networks. Use this type when you want to allow communication only between virtual machines on the same virtualizationserver. A private virtual network is not bound to a physical network adapter. A private virtual network is isolated from all external network traffic on the virtualizationserver, as well any network traffic between the management operating system and the external network. This type of network is useful when you need to create an isolated networking environment, such as an isolated test domain.
